
Phillips: Newcastle are ‘shambles’ and ‘bizarre’ news is the last thing Bruce needs
Kevin Phillips has labelled the latest statement out of Newcastle as “bizarre” and called the club a “shambles”.
The Sunderland legend, speaking exclusively to Football Insider, reacted to the Magpies’ recent release.
On 3 September, Newcastle released a statement defending their lack of spending this summer.
The club reiterated its commitment to a sustainable business model “built on the principle that we will spend what we have.”
The statement was ripped apart by furious Newcastle fans on social media with some of the anger coming from the fact that no one had put their name on the release.
On Friday (10 September), Daily Mail reporter Craig Hope shared what Bruce said when asked about Newcastle’s statement last week.
Bruce said, “What can I do about it?”, when asked if he was happy with the situation.
Phillips insists the statement is the last thing Bruce needed after Newcastle’s poor start to the season.
“It’s another bizarre thing that has happened at Newcastle over the last 10 years,” Phillips told Football Insider‘s Ben Wild.
“I’m just talking in general, not even with a red and white head on. I want the best for all football clubs.
“Why come out and say anything at all? The supporters know why things have happened, they aren’t daft.
“Ashley doesn’t want to spend because he wants to sell the club, why would he spend?
“Why does that statement need to come out with no name on it? It’s a bizarre situation.

“That’s the last thing Bruce needs that considering the start they have had. It’s just another saga they don’t need.
“From the outside looking in it’s a shambles.”
